If you still have halogen torchiere light fixtures — Amazon still sells them
— throw them out! But, you say, halogen torchieres put out a hell of a lot of light and don't cost very much. Why throw them out?
Well, first, halogen lamps get hot, hot enough to start fires if the lamp gets knocked over. (Halogen light bulbs are every bit as inefficient as incandescent light bulbs, after all.) All of this heat makes your air conditioner work much harder than it needs to, which is an important factor in the summertime. How much heat? So much heat that you can actually buy an oven powered by halogen light bulbs.
And, possibly most important, halogen torchieres use 300-watt light bulbs. 300 watts! There is no way you could possibly need that much light at any one point in any room of your house — wherever possible, use lighting appropriate to what you actually need at the time.
